WARNING! Do not drive with worn or dirty
wiper blades. They can reduce visibility, mak-
ing driving hazardous. Clean blades regularly
to remove road film and wax build-up. Use an
alcohol-based cleaning solution and a lint-
free cloth, and wipe along the blades.
CAUTION: Do not use antifreeze or engine
coolant in the windshield washer reservoir—
damage to seals and other components will
result.
Intermittent Windshield Wiper Control
Two-speed intermittent windshield wipers are controlled
by the control panel knob with the symbol shown above.
To turn on the wipers, rotate the knob to the right.
As you turn the knob further to the right, intermittent delay
decreases until the knob encounters the first position for
continuous operation. Turn the knob further right to the
next position for higher speed continuous operation. Turn
off the wipers by rotating the knob to the left.
Air Suspension Deflate Switch (Dump Valve)
AIR SUSPENSION
03035
Your Model 387 may have an air suspension deflation
switch that allows the air in the suspension to be
exhausted from a switch on the dash. The purpose of this
feature is to allow you to lower your tractor to get under a
trailer. You will notice a guard over the switch. This pre
-
vents you from accidentally deflating the suspension.
WARNING! Operating the Air Suspension
Deflate Switch (Dump Valve) while driving can
lead to an accident. Sudden deflation while
your vehicle is moving can affect handling
and control. Use this switch only when your
vehicle is not moving.
